When HCl (hydrochloric acid, also known as muriatic acid) is added to copper, the copper forms a protective layer against HCl which prevents attack against the copper metal. I wouldn't worry too much about the concentration of HCl eating the copper, but keeping it around 10% is a good idea for safety reasons. Whatever you do, don't use nitric acid though. Nitric is the only acid available to households that can eat copper.. and it will, violently! Muriatic acid from hardware stores should not contain any nitric acid, but it's always best to check the MSDS sheets on google before using any chemicals.

Most muriatic acid that I have encountered is about 30-35% concentration. In order to dilute, fill a jar or bottle with water and then SLOWLY add the acid to the jar of water. Do not inhale any fumes if they rise. Depending on the speed that you add the acid to the water, the mixture could heat up so add slowly. Never add water to the acid unless you want it to instantly go from 21c to 100c in a matter of seconds and burn you, tossing fumes everywhere as well as well as deadly chlorine gas. I'd also use a respirator like a 3M one rated for chlorine gas, splash goggles, and have a bucket of cold water around along with a box of baking soda to wash anything if you have a spill. You pour the baking soda directly on the acid spill. Safety first!

This may all sound like overkill, but one day something will happen when working with vile chemicals, and you will be happy you took the time to be safe. You will lose your vision if you splash HCl in your eyes. Imagine not being able to see and trying to get help... not fun.

If you get HCl on your skin like your fingers, it's not as bad if you wash it off right away. But still wear gloves! I've got 34.1% HCl on my fingers and it feels oily.. it starts to sting about 5-10 seconds after contact on skin but if you wash with cold water immediately you're fine. Still, don't get it on your skin in the first place!

Actually fluxes are either acid/water based which would clean out with steam/vinegar or rosin based which is recommended to clean out with isopropanol, or any alcohol. So I would think a sacrificial run of ethanol would clean out a rosin based flux whereas a vinegar run being water based would not.
